Understanding Typical Vision Issues in Children
When it pertains to your kid's development, recognizing common vision problems is important. Children can face numerous eye problems, consisting of n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ism. These conditions may lead to difficulties in learning, playing, or engaging with others.
If you observe your child scrunching up your eyes, rubbing their eyes, or having trouble concentrating, it is essential to pay attention. Early detection can make a considerable difference in their general advancement and scholastic success.
Strabismus, or went across eyes, and amblyopia, called careless eye, are other problems that can affect vision. These conditions often require timely therapy to prevent long-lasting difficulties.

Therapy Options for Vision Problems in Kids
Several reliable therapy options exist for dealing with vision troubles in kids, customized to their particular demands. Depending upon the diagnosis, your kid might take advantage of restorative glasses or call lenses, which can dramatically improve their visual acuity.
For problems like amblyopia, patching the stronger eye can help enhance the weak one. Sometimes, vision treatment involving eye exercises may be recommended to boost coordination and focus.
If your child has strabismus (gone across eyes), surgical treatment could be necessary to straighten the eyes. Furthermore, regular follow-up gos to with a pediatric eye professional make sure that their treatment continues to be effective and modifications are made as required.
It's vital to deal with these concerns early for the best possible results.
